Your prayer from a burdened heart has been heard, and I thank you for bringing it honestly before God. You ask that an event from 2013 would be taken away, and I understand how heavy a memory can remain even after many years.

Scripture does not teach that God rewinds history so that what happened never happened, but it does teach that He removes guilt and brings healing to those who come to Him through Jesus Christ. If we confess our sins, He is faithful and just to forgive us and to cleanse us from all unrighteousness. As far as the east is from the west, so far does He remove our transgressions from us when we are in Christ.

If this event involves sin, whether sin you committed or sin committed against you, the best way to find peace is to name it plainly before God in prayer, not only in general words but as it truly is. When you tell Him specifically what troubles your conscience, you learn more deeply how great His forgiveness is, and you grow in thankfulness to Him. There is a sorrow that is according to God, which leads to repentance that brings salvation and no regret. That sorrow looks to Christ for mercy and turns away from sin. There is also a sorrow that only wishes the past would disappear and leaves the heart still sick. God invites you to the first kind, which brings life.

Healing is often like medicine applied over time. The soul is exercised by continual hearing of the Scriptures and by steady prayer. Even if you do not feel release today, do not despair and do not stop seeking Him. Many have heard the word many times without sensing change, and then at last the fruit has appeared all at once, because God was working through all those prayers and all that hearing. Persevere in His word, in prayer, and in fellowship with faithful believers.
